Power Problems

A common issue with the Aiper Seagull 800 is power problems. Sometimes, the unit might not turn on at all.

Ensure that the battery is charged. If the battery is fully charged and it still doesn’t power up, check the power switch.

Also, inspect the charging port for any debris or damage. A simple cleaning might resolve the problem.

Movement Issues

Movement issues are another frequent problem. The Aiper Seagull 800 may move slowly or not at all.

First, check for any obstructions in the wheels or tracks. Sometimes debris can get stuck and hinder movement.

Another aspect to check is the water flow. Ensure that the water intake is not blocked.

If these steps don’t resolve the issue, consider recalibrating the unit following the manufacturer’s instructions.

Charging Tips

First and foremost, ensure you’re using the original charger provided by Aiper. It’s specifically designed for your Seagull 800 and using other chargers can cause issues.

Always charge your device in a cool, dry place. Extreme temperatures can affect the battery’s performance and lifespan. For instance, avoid charging it near windows where it can be exposed to direct sunlight.

Check the connection points for any dirt or debris. A clean connection ensures efficient charging. Use a soft, dry cloth to clean these points periodically.

Navigation Errors

Experiencing navigation errors with your Aiper Seagull 800 can be frustrating. These issues often stem from obstacle detection and directional control problems. By addressing these areas, you can improve your device’s performance.

Obstacle Detection

Obstacle detection ensures the Aiper Seagull 800 avoids collisions. If the device frequently bumps into objects, check the sensors. Clean them carefully to remove any debris. Sometimes, recalibrating the sensors helps. Follow the manual for specific steps.

Directional Control

Directional control is crucial for proper navigation. If the device moves erratically, inspect the wheels. Ensure they are free from dirt and debris. Regular maintenance of wheels can prevent directional issues. Resetting the control system may also resolve these problems.

Regular Cleaning

Regular cleaning of your Aiper Seagull 800 is essential. Make it a habit to clean the filters after each use. This ensures that debris and dirt do not clog the system.

Use a soft brush to remove any particles stuck in the filter. A clogged filter can reduce the efficiency of your device.

Check the propellers for any tangled debris. If you find any, remove them carefully to avoid damaging the propellers.

Storage Advice

Proper storage is key to maintaining your Aiper Seagull 800. After using it, ensure it is completely dry before storing. Moisture can lead to mold and mildew, which can damage the device.

Store your Aiper Seagull 800 in a cool, dry place. Avoid leaving it in direct sunlight or in areas with extreme temperatures.

Use a protective cover if possible. This prevents dust and dirt from settling on your device, keeping it clean and ready for the next use.

Update Process

Updating the Aiper Seagull 800 is simple. First, connect your device to a stable Wi-Fi network. Next, open the Aiper app on your smartphone. Look for the settings menu in the app.

In the settings menu, find the “Software Update” option. Tap on it to check for the latest updates. If an update is available, the app will prompt you to download and install it.

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the update. The device may restart during the process. Ensure it stays connected to Wi-Fi until the update finishes.

Troubleshooting Firmware

Firmware issues can sometimes occur. If the update process fails, try these steps. First, check your Wi-Fi connection. Ensure it is stable and strong.

If the connection is fine, restart your device and try again. Sometimes a simple restart fixes the problem. If the issue persists, reset the device to factory settings. This can resolve deeper issues.

To reset the device, go to the settings menu in the app. Find the “Factory Reset” option and follow the instructions. Remember, this will erase all your settings and data. Backup important information before resetting.

Remote Control Issues

Facing remote control issues with your Aiper Seagull 800 can be frustrating. These problems can affect the performance of your device. In this section, we will discuss common remote control issues and how to fix them.

Pairing Problems

Ensure the remote control is properly paired with the Aiper Seagull 800. Start by turning off both the device and the remote. Turn them back on and attempt to pair them again.

If pairing fails, check the batteries in the remote. Weak batteries can cause pairing issues. Replace the batteries if needed. Additionally, ensure there is no dirt or debris on the remote’s sensors.

Still having trouble? Try resetting the remote control. Refer to the user manual for specific instructions. Resetting can often resolve pairing problems.

Signal Interference

Signal interference can disrupt the connection between the remote and the Aiper Seagull 800. Remove any objects blocking the line of sight between the remote and the device.

Other electronic devices can also cause interference. Keep the remote and the device away from Wi-Fi routers, microwaves, and other electronics.

If the problem persists, move to a different location. Sometimes, changing the location can reduce signal interference and improve performance.
